Beginning as a deceptively ordinary drama about a lonely widower looking for companionship, Audition climaxes in an out of control into an endurance test of the audiences' nerves. Shigeharu Aoyama is the likeable owner of a television production company and a devoted father. Seeing his father's loneliness the son encourages him to marry again. His colleague Yoshikawa has a simple, ethically dubious idea: hold auditions for a fake television project to canvas potential wives. Despite his hesitations about the plan Aoyama agrees. At the auditions he comes across the strikingly beautiful Asami Yamasaki, a 24 year-old ex-dancer with a shy and demure manner. Aoyama becomes obsessed with the young girl and a relationship ensues. All is not as it seems with this obedient, seemingly docile woman. Blinded by his obsession Aoyama is oblivious. Whether considered J-horror, psychological thriller or social commentary, Audition is a visceral experience - the work of an original and creative filmmaker.
